The Cumberland Arms, April 18th
The Early Purple is the indie-folk project of Northumbrian musician Matt Saxon, blending Fleet Foxes’ warmth with Midlake’s depth through rich three-part harmonies, finger-picked acoustic guitars, ethereal synths and gently driving percussion. Working closely with producer Will Thorneycroft (The Dawdler and Lovely Assistant), Saxon has earned praise for his evocative, introspective songwriting, with releases described as “lush ghost-folk” and “heartfelt indie-folk” by The Glasshouse and Narc Magazine. Recent highlights include the release of the richly textured single The Greek Key, featuring contributions from Sam Fender, alongside appearances at BBC Proms, a residency at the Glasshouse Summer Studios, and supporting acts such as Flyte, Efterklang, John Francis Flynn and Bernard Butler, cementing his reputation as one of the North East’s most thoughtful and distinctive songwriters.
